Today I helped a client set up their WiFi and learned some interesting things about WiFi channels and common misconceptions about 5G vs 5GHz.

WiFi Channels Explained

WiFi networks operate on specific frequency channels. I learned that:

  1. 2.4GHz band has 14 channels (though only 1-11 are used in the US)
  2. 5GHz band has many more channels (36-165 depending on region)

The key insight: Adjacent channels overlap and cause interference! For 2.4GHz networks, only channels 1, 6, and 11 don’t overlap with each other.
